A Research On The Cross-cultural Conflict Phenomena Of European Employees In Shenyang And Teaching Strategies

This thesis mainly investigates the cross-cultural conflicts of European employees in Shenyang.Take the students of a Chinese language training institution in Shenyang as an example.Through questionnaire surveys and individual interviews,to know about the problems they encounter in actual work,study and life,and propose corresponding teaching settings and suggestions.The thesis is divided into six parts:The first part is the introduction,which mainly introduces the research background and research significance of the thesis,clarifies the research methods and related theoretical basis of the thesis,and combs the existing theories and research status.The studies before indicate that current research pays less attention to the phenomena of cultural conflicts encountered by European employees.Based on this,the research direction and content of this thesis have been determined.That is,questionnaire surveys are adopted as the main method and interviews are used as supplementary methods.To investigate the phenomena of cross-cultural conflict of European employees.This part clarifies the survey object and content of the article,and has a certain grasp of the overall writing direction of the thesis.The second part summarizes the research content from the two aspects of the definition and causes of cross-cultural conflict.On this basis,a questionnaire for cross-cultural conflicts of European employees in Shenyang has been set up,and a brief introduction to the questionnaire and survey subjects is also been provided.In terms of the questionnaire,the source of the questionnaire,the sampling and recovery of the questionnaire were explained.In terms of survey subjects,briefly sorted out their basic information such as nationality,age,and Chinese proficiency,and analyzed their current cross-cultural adaptation.It is concluded that the current acculturation mode of the survey subjects is closer to the integration mode,and the acculturation stages are basically distributed in the three stages of frustration,recovery and adaptation.This part roughly introduces the characteristics of the subjects of survey and their current adaptation to Chinese culture.The third part is the results and analysis of survey,from the five aspects of verbal communication,non-verbal communication,social communication,interpersonal relations,and living habits and customs to investigate the phenomenon of cross-cultural conflicts among European employees,and analyze the causes of cultural conflicts.It is concluded that the main reasons for the question of cross-cultural conflicts of the subjects are the lack of knowledge of Chinese culture and cross-cultural communication,the differences in thinking styles and values between China and Europe,and the individual differences of the subjects.In general,this part basically clarifies the cross-cultural conflicts that the survey respondents face and their causes.The fourth part aims at the cross-cultural conflict phenomena of the subjects,and combines their learning needs,proposes the teaching settings to deal with the cross-cultural conflict phenomenon from the perspectives of classroom teaching and extracurricular activities,so as to improve the Chinese level of the subjects,increase cultural knowledge reserves.These teaching settings are: course settings that combine language practice ability and cultural knowledge,personalized cultural curriculum settings that "put what they like",immersive cultural practice activities,regional cultural outdoor activities,and post-work cultural summary activities.In this part,starting from the actual situation of the subjects,a series of teachings setting with certain application value are proposed.The fifth part is the feedback of the teaching setting proposed by the survey objects,and the teaching suggestions for Chinese teachers.From students’ feedback,it is concluded that the proposed teaching settings are indeed effective and have certain application value.At the same time,five suggestions are put forward: to pay close attention to the actual problems encountered by students;fully understand the individual learning needs of students;strengthen the cultural teaching of the students’ geographical background;use contextual advantages and focus on cultural experience;adopt a teaching method that pays attention to cultural differences.The sixth part is the conclusion,which briefly summarizes the research content and innovations of the thesis,and reflects on the deficiencies of the research.The innovations of this thesis can provide teachers with certain guidance and provide reference for follow-up research.The shortcomings of this thesis can also provide some improvement ideas for subsequent research.Through investigation and analysis,this article basically understands the phenomenon and causes of cross-cultural conflicts among European employees in Shenyang,and puts forward targeted suggestions based on their learning needs.
